The Wars of the Jews, 4.401

Flavius Josephus  translated by William Whiston

« J. BJ 4.400 | J. BJ 4.401 | J. BJ 4.402 | About This Work »

401But when once they were informed that the Roman army lay still, and that the Jews were divided between sedition and tyranny, they boldly undertook greater matters;
